Artist Biography For Ramin Djawadi

Ramin Djawadi Born 19 July 1974 Is A German Film Score Composer Conductor And Record Producer. He Is Known For His Scores For The HBO Series Game Of Thrones For Which He Was Nominated For Grammy Awards In 2018 And 2020. He Is Also The Composer For The HBO Game Of Thrones Prequel Series House Of The Dragon 2022–present . He Has Scored Films Such As Clash Of The Titans Pacific Rim Warcraft A Wrinkle In Time Iron Man And Eternals Television Series Including Prison Break Person Of Interest Jack Ryan And Westworld And Video Games Such As Medal Of Honor Gears Of War 4 And Gears 5. He Won Two Consecutive Emmy Awards For Game Of Thrones In 2018 For The Episode "The Dragon And The Wolf" And In 2019 For "The Long Night". Djawadi Was Born In Duisburg To An Iranian Father And A German Mother. He Went To Krupp Gymnasium In Duisburg West Germany And Studied At Berklee College Of Music. After Graduating From Berklee College Of Music In 1998 Djawadi Garnered The Attention Of Hans Zimmer Who Recruited Him To Remote Control Productions. Djawadi Moved To Los Angeles And Worked As An Assistant To Klaus Badelt. From There On He Made Additional Music And Arrangements For Badelt And Zimmer Movies Such As Pirates Of The Caribbean The Curse Of The Black Pearl The Time Machine And The Academy Award-Nominated Film Something's Gotta Give. Djawadi Is Married To Jennifer Hawks A Music Executive In The Film Industry. They Are Parents Of Twins. According To Djawadi He Experiences The Perceptual Phenomenon Known As Synesthesia Whereby He May "associate Colours With Music Or Music With Colours" And It Allows Him To Visualize Music.
